Helium gas in a balloon occupies 2.5 L at 300.0 K. The balloon is dipped into liquid nitrogen that is at a temperature of 77.0 K
Rom4ik [11]

Answer:

A. 0.641 L

Explanation:

<em>Given data:</em>

V1 = 2.5 L

T1 = 300.0 K

T2= 77.0 K

<em>To find: </em>

V2= ?

<em>Formula :</em>

By using Charles’ Law

\frac{V_1}{T_1}  = \frac{V_2}{T_2}

\frac{V_1}{T_1} . {T_2}  = {V_2}

<em>Calculation:</em>

V2 = 2.5 L x 77.0 K / 300.0 K

    = 192.5 / 300.0 k

V2    = 0.641 L
